Inclusion criteria

Inclusion criteria: Children aged 6 to 12, who are diagnosed with ASD at the department of child psychiatry. All children who will be prescribed risperidone for stereotypic behavior, but who are medication-naive at the beginning of the study, will be asked to participate. Based on the known male: female ratio of about 4:1 (Fombonne, 2002), we expect to include around 20 boys and 5 girls in our study. Diagnostic criteria are according to the DSM-IV (APA, 1994), and verified by the ADOS (Lord et al., 1989) and ADI-R (Lord et al., 1994). IQs of all participants will be measured by the Wechsler Intelligence Scale for Children, Dutch edition (WISC-III-NL).

Exclusion criteria

Exclusion criteria: Individuals who are either not medication-naive at baseline, with a known brain dysfunction, total IQ score below 75 or with psychiatric pathology other than ASD will be excluded.

Design outcomes

Primary

MeasureTime frame
The Error-Related negativity (ERN) is a peak in the ERP signal measured directly after the participant makes a mistake; in the case of the Go/ NoGo task, this means that the ERN is measured when the participant inadvertently presses the response button with a NoGo trial. The ERN is a measure of self-monitoring, which is hypothesized to be low in children with ASD with rigid behavior at baseline. The use of risperidone enhances cingulate cortex activity, resulting in larger ERN amplitudes. Response times, and particularly the delay in reaction time after making a mistake, are also measured. Usually, the reaction times after an erronous response are slower; we expect that this post-error slowing at baseline is relatively small in children with ASD, but that it increases due to the use of risperidone. Both effect measures will be correlated with the degree of rigid behavior in the children with ASD, here we expect stronger effects with higher levels of rigid behavior at baseline.

Secondary

MeasureTime frame
Source localizations of the ERN are applied, meaning that it is measured whether the ERN can actually be located in the anterior cingulate cortex. This source localization is done by using Brain Electrical Source Analysis software. Previous studies have shown that using 64 electrodes, as it is the case in our study, will provide robust signals that are appropriate for measuring ERN source localization (Vlamings et al, 2008).
